6. Legacy Subaru
Model Years: 1989–Present;
Average Yearly Repair Cost: $469*
Since going into production in 1989, Subaru’s flagship vehicle, the Legacy, has established a reputation for being a dependable midsize car that meets the needs of its owners to a sufficient extent, despite having yearly maintenance costs ($563) that are higher than the average for midsize cars ($526).

Given that Legacy owners have reported enjoying their cars’ comfort for up to 20 years or 300,000 miles, the greater servicing costs of the Legacy may not be a negative thing.
